Navigating the Post-Strike Creative Renaissance

Over the past year, the filmmaking ecosystem has experienced a profound shift. Following the industry agreements of recent years, the film director has emerged as a crucial gatekeeper protecting creative integrity against unchecked automation. Auteurs are increasingly demanding final-cut privileges and strict guardrails on how generative AI is utilized in pre-visualization and post-production.

This resistance has sparked a renewed interest in practical effects, analog shooting formats, and authentic, character-driven narratives. Audiences are showing a clear preference for distinct directorial voices over cookie-cutter studio products. Consequently, major studios are once again trusting directors with substantial budgets to execute original, high-concept visions rather than relying solely on established franchise templates.

The power dynamic between directors and streaming algorithms has also reached a critical tipping point. High-profile filmmakers are negotiating contracts that guarantee minimum theatrical windows before their projects transition to digital formats. This shift ensures that the cinematic experience—meticulously crafted by the director, cinematographer, and sound designer—is preserved for its initial audience run.

Where to Watch the Most Anticipated Directorial Cuts This Season

For cinephiles looking to experience these directorial visions as intended, the distribution landscape in late 2026 offers several distinct avenues:



  • Premium Large Format (PLF) Theaters: Directors championing IMAX and 70mm projection formats require audiences to seek out premium screens. Tickets for these limited-run engagements often sell out weeks in advance, particularly in major metropolitan hubs.
  • Curated Streaming Platforms: Services like MUBI, Criterion Channel, and Apple TV+ have carved out dedicated spaces for international and independent directors. These platforms frequently offer exclusive "Director’s Cut" editions and behind-the-scenes commentary.
  • International Film Festivals: The upcoming Venice, Telluride, and Toronto film festivals remain the premier destinations to catch world premieres. Securing press passes or public screening tickets remains the best way to view these projects ahead of their commercial release dates.
